A VPN, or Virtual Private Network, is a security measure that connects two or more devices over a public network, providing a secure connection. This is crucial for protecting internet traffic from interception. VPN clients are applications that enable users to connect to VPN services, offering advanced features and security.
Key Features and Benefits of VPN Clients
-
Encryption and Tunneling:
- VPN clients use encryption (e.g., AES) to protect data, making it inaccessible to unauthorized parties.
- Data is tunnelled through a VPN server, hiding its origin and destination.
